NextBlock VC as a funder

Investment thesis

NextBlock believes blockchain is foundational infrastructure, emphasizing protocols and companies building blockchain rails, with a focus on cryptographic foundations and serious applications.

Focus narrative

NextBlock invests in blockchain technology, targeting early-stage companies from pre-seed to Series B. The firm is particularly interested in projects that focus on blockchain infrastructure, cryptography, Web3, asset tokenization, and compliance solutions. By fostering innovation in these areas, NextBlock aims to facilitate the broader adoption of blockchain technology across various sectors.

Value beyond capital

NextBlock provides strategic support to its portfolio companies by leveraging its expertise in blockchain technology and its extensive network within the industry. The firm aims to help founders navigate the complexities of the blockchain landscape, offering insights into market trends, regulatory considerations, and technological advancements.

Portfolio and track record

Portfolio context

Argent — Crypto wallet / account abstraction infrastructure. Celestia — Modular blockchain infrastructure. Consensys — Ethereum software and infrastructure company. Forta — Blockchain security / attack detection network. Notabene — Crypto compliance and Travel Rule infrastructure. Parfin — Digital-asset infrastructure for financial institutions. Bit2Me — European crypto infrastructure and exchange; invested alongside Tether in a EUR 2.5m round.
